How can businesses effectively balance the need for innovation and flexibility in their internal processes with the desire to maintain consistency and reliability for their customers?
Businesses can effectively balance the need for innovation and flexibility by implementing agile methodologies that allow for quick adaptation to changing market demands while still maintaining consistency and reliability for customers. This can be achieved by fostering a culture of continuous improvement and encouraging experimentation within the organization. Additionally, businesses can invest in technology that enables them to streamline processes and automate repetitive tasks, freeing up resources to focus on innovation. Ultimately, the key is to strike a balance between embracing change and ensuring that core processes remain stable and reliable to meet customer expectations.
